Introduction to Remote Sensing Analysis Using QGIS

Learn how to interpret and analyze satellite imagery using QGIS with Eric Purdie. Eric is a GIS instructor at Algonquin College.

Participants will learn how to interpret and analyze satellite imagery using QGIS.  The instructor will guide participants through each learning goal step-by-step live online. This course uses datasets based on real-world GIS projects and QGIS. Students will gain an understanding of how to leverage QGIS open-source analysis tools to ask and answer questions to solve real world issues.

Topics covered: Image processing (e.g. Error correction and projection), analysis (e.g. NDVI, Tasseled Cap Transformation, and Supervised Classification using AI/ML), and terrain analysis (e.g. Creating DSM’s & DTM’s with LiDAR datasets).
